WebApr 13, 2024 · This was backed up by historical milk market data, which saw average butterfat tests in the Upper Midwest hovering between 3.7% and 3.8% from 2000 to 2012. Fast-forward 10 years and we have seen this number rapidly increase, with 2024 seeing an average milk fat of over 4.0% for the first time. WebDec 7, 2024 · While the fat content of goat and cow milk is similar, the fat globules in goat milk are smaller. That makes it easier for your body to digest. Once it reaches your stomach, the protein in goat’s milk forms a softer curd than cow milk . Only about 2 percent of goat’s milk is curd compared to about 10 percent in cow milk. The fat content of milk is the proportion of milk, by weight, made up by butterfat. The fat content, particularly of cow's milk, is modified to make a variety of products. The fat content of milk is usually stated on the container, and the color of the label or milk bottle top varied to enable quick recognition.
